The 7 Best Beach Resorts in Korea

beach resort in kroea

When people think of traveling to Korea, Seoul is usually the first destination that comes to mind. But beyond the capital, Korea has beautiful coastlines, lively beach cities, peaceful seaside towns, and resorts overlooking the ocean.

From the clear blue waters of Gangwon-do to the luxury hotels of Busan and the volcanic coastline of Jeju Island, Korea offers many different ways to enjoy a beach vacation.

If you are looking for the best beach resorts in Korea, here are seven places worth considering for your next trip.

1. SIGNIEL BUSAN – Luxury by Haeundae Beach

SIGNIEL BUSAN

Location: Busan
Best for: Couples, luxury travelers, and first-time visitors

Located beside Haeundae Beach, SIGNIEL BUSAN is one of Korea’s most luxurious oceanfront hotels. Its rooms offer panoramic views of the sea, while the outdoor infinity pool makes it possible to enjoy the Haeundae skyline without leaving the hotel.

Haeundae is also one of the most convenient beach areas for international travelers. Restaurants, cafés, traditional markets, and attractions such as the Haeundae Beach Train and Sky Capsule are all nearby.

Choose SIGNIEL BUSAN if you want to combine a relaxing resort stay with the energy and convenience of Korea’s second-largest city.

2. Paradise Hotel Busan – A Classic Beachfront Stay

Paradise Hotel Busan

Location: Busan
Best for: Families, couples, and travelers who want direct beach access

Paradise Hotel Busan is another well-known resort located directly along Haeundae Beach. It is especially popular with travelers who want to spend time at the beach while still having easy access to Busan’s restaurants, markets, and nightlife.

The resort includes ocean-view rooms, outdoor spa facilities, swimming pools, and family-friendly spaces. Compared with a quiet remote resort, Paradise Hotel is a good choice for visitors who want both relaxation and plenty of things to do nearby.

From here, you can also explore Haedong Yonggungsa Temple, Cheongsapo, Gwangalli Beach, and Busan’s famous seafood markets.

3. Cassia Sokcho – Ocean Views Near Seoraksan

Cassia Sokcho

Location: Sokcho, Gangwon-do
Best for: Nature lovers, families, and travelers combining the sea and mountains

Sokcho is one of Korea’s most popular coastal destinations among locals. What makes it special is that travelers can enjoy the East Sea and Seoraksan National Park during the same trip.

Cassia Sokcho offers modern accommodation with wide ocean views and resort-style facilities. It is a comfortable base for exploring Sokcho Beach, Oeongchi Coastal Trail, Abai Village, local markets, and Seoraksan.

This is an excellent option if you want more than a typical beach holiday. You can watch the sunrise over the sea in the morning, explore mountain trails during the day, and finish your evening with fresh seafood at Sokcho Tourist and Fishery Market.

4. Skybay Hotel Gyeongpo – Between the Lake and the Sea

Skybay Hotel Gyeongpo

Location: Gangneung, Gangwon-do
Best for: Short trips from Seoul, café lovers, and couples

Skybay Hotel Gyeongpo sits between Gyeongpo Beach and Gyeongpo Lake, giving travelers access to two of Gangneung’s most famous landscapes.

Gangneung is one of the easiest coastal cities to reach from Seoul by KTX. This makes it a good choice for travelers who want to add a beach destination to their Korea itinerary without taking a domestic flight.

In addition to Gyeongpo Beach, visitors can explore Anmok Coffee Street, traditional markets, coastal walking paths, and local restaurants. Gangneung is particularly enjoyable for travelers who prefer cafés, quiet walks, and a slower atmosphere.

5. Sol Beach Yangyang – A Relaxing East Coast Resort

Sol Beach Yangyang

Location: Yangyang, Gangwon-do
Best for: Families, groups, and travelers looking for a complete resort experience

Inspired by Mediterranean architecture, Sol Beach Yangyang feels different from the modern high-rise hotels found in Korea’s larger cities. The resort has access to a private beach and a seaside walking trail, allowing guests to enjoy the East Sea in a quieter setting.

Yangyang is also known as Korea’s leading surfing destination. Surfyy Beach, Hajodae Beach, and several local surf shops and cafés have made the area especially popular with younger Korean travelers.

Sol Beach Yangyang is suitable for families and groups who want to spend more time inside the resort, while still having the option to experience Korea’s local surfing culture.

6. Sol Beach Samcheok – Dramatic Coastal Scenery

Sol Beach Samcheok

Location: Samcheok, Gangwon-do
Best for: Road trips, families, and travelers seeking a quieter coast

Samcheok is less internationally known than Busan or Jeju, but its rugged coastline and clear East Sea views make it one of Korea’s hidden seaside destinations.

Sol Beach Samcheok is built on an elevated section of the coast, providing open views of the sea. The resort’s Santorini-inspired design, family facilities, and walking areas make it a comfortable place for a slower vacation.

Because Samcheok is farther from Seoul than Gangneung or Sokcho, it works best as part of a private road trip along Korea’s east coast. Nearby attractions can include Jangho Port, coastal rail bikes, caves, beaches, and small fishing villages.

7. Parnas Hotel Jeju – A Luxury Escape in Jungmun

Parnas Hotel Jeju

Location: Jeju Island
Best for: Honeymoons, couples, families, and luxury vacations

Located in Jungmun, Seogwipo, Parnas Hotel Jeju is surrounded by Jeju Island’s dramatic southern coastline. The resort is known for its ocean views and long infinity pool overlooking the sea.

Jungmun is one of the most convenient resort areas in Jeju. From here, travelers can visit waterfalls, volcanic landscapes, tea fields, coastal trails, museums, and local restaurants.

Parnas Hotel Jeju is particularly suitable for honeymoons and special occasions. However, it also works well for families who want resort facilities combined with easy access to Jeju’s major attractions.

Which Beach Resort in Korea Is Right for You?

trip

The best choice depends on the type of vacation you want.

  • Choose Busan if you want beaches, restaurants, nightlife, and city attractions.
  • Choose Sokcho if you want to combine the ocean with Seoraksan National Park.
  • Choose Gangneung for an easy beach trip from Seoul and Korea’s coastal café culture.
  • Choose Yangyang for surfing and a relaxed local atmosphere.
  • Choose Samcheok for a quieter east coast road trip.
  • Choose Jeju Island for a longer resort vacation surrounded by nature.

When Is the Best Time to Visit Korea’s Beach Resorts?

The main beach season in Korea runs from late June through August, with July and August being the busiest months.

For fewer crowds, consider visiting in May, June, September, or early October. Swimming and beach facilities may be limited outside the official summer season, but the weather can be more comfortable for sightseeing, coastal walks, and road trips.

Busan and Jeju are also suitable for seaside stays outside summer. Although it may be too cold to swim, travelers can still enjoy ocean views, cafés, seafood, and nearby attractions.
